Job Description


We are seeking a dedicated and reliable non-CDL Driver to join our team. As a non-CDL Driver, you will be responsible for safely operating transit vehicles, ensuring excellent customer service, and complying with all relevant laws and regulations. You will play a vital role in providing transportation services to the general public, including individuals with disabilities and the elderly.

Responsibilities:

  • Transit vehicles safely operate according to the schedule or printed manifest.
  • Ensure compliance with DOT laws and regulations.
  • Perform vehicle inspections before and after each trip, ensuring safety and operational efficiency.
  • Maintain cleanliness of vehicles.
  • Communicate effectively with dispatch and supervisory personnel regarding operational issues.
  • Provide exceptional customer service to passengers, including assisting individuals with disabilities.
  • Collect fares from passengers and ensure proper payment.
  • Report traffic accidents, customer incidents, and complete all required logs and reports.
  • Assist in emergency evacuations and recovery activities, as assigned.
  • Follow safety procedures when operating lift systems and securing wheelchairs, scooters, and other assistive devices.
  • Maintain confidentiality and adhere to policies, including Drug & Alcohol, ADA, EEO, Title VI, and Code of Conduct.

 

Job Requirements

Qualifications:

  • Equivalent to a high school diploma.
  • Valid Texas Driver’s License.
  • DOT physical certification.
  • Ability to speak, read, and write in English.
  • Legible handwriting and basic math skills.
  • Ability to understand and follow instructions and read maps.
  • Familiarity with state and local traffic laws and regulations.
  • Ability to stay alert and operate vehicles safely under varying conditions.

Physical Requirements:

  • Frequent driving, sitting, and grasping.
  • Occasional lifting (up to 50 pounds) and walking.
  • Ability to detect sounds such as vehicle horns and emergency sirens.
  • Constant need for vision acuity for vehicle operation.
  • Exposure to outdoor conditions including temperature extremes, vehicle fumes, and varying weather.
  • Ability to work under challenging conditions and handle various physical tasks.
